Roku TV won't update software

My Roku TV was last updated Oct/2022. I would not have noticed if it hadn't been for one of the streaming platforms I use requiring the software on the TV to be updated. But it won't update. Gives me error code 008. The version the TV is currently using is 11.5.0. Anyone ever figure this issue out? TIA
